Predictors of the Efficacy of Dipeptidyl Peptidase-4 Inhibitors in Taiwanese Patients with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us

2019 
Background/purpose Dipeptidyl peptidase-4 (DPP-4) inhibitors are the most popular oral antidiabetic drugs (OADs) in recent 20 years because of the low risk of hypoglycemia, intermediate efficacy to lower glycated hemoglobin (△HbA1c): 0.5–0.9%, neutral effect on body weight change, convenience for usage (mostly once daily), and rare occurrence of major side effects. The purpose of this study was to determine the important predictors of the efficacy of naive use of DPP-4 inhibitors in Taiwanese pat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2D).
